The National Library and Information System Authority (NALIS), in association with the Trinidad and Tobago Football Federation (TTFF) will be holding a National Heritage Exhibit in May, highlighting this country’s history of World Cup Qualification attempts.

FIFA and the  CodeOrganising Committee for the FIFA World Cup 2006  has put a hold on allowing access for Steelpan and other iron-made  musical instruments being taken into the Stadiums for Trinidad and Tobago’s matches in the June tournament.
